How much does a personal trainer earn in Thornton, CO?

The average personal trainer in Thornton, CO earns between $28,000 and $58,000 annually. This compares to the national average personal trainer range of $26,000 to $53,000.

Average personal trainer salary in Thornton, CO

$40,000
